Summit Entertainment's The Twilight Saga: Eclipse Features the Volvo XC60


The Twilight Saga is one of the most popular film franchises and once again Edward Cullen drives a Volvo XC60.

 

Search on the Internet using the string "Volvo/Twilight/Eclipse" and you will get more than two million hits, including photographs and lengthy fan discussions of the exact colour nuance of Edward Cullen's Volvo. The interest is astonishing.

 

"The opportunity to participate in such a successful film franchise is a wonderful opportunity. Since Edward drives a Volvo in the novels, our participation is both credible and logical," says Oliver Engling, project manager for Volvo Car's "Lost in Forks" promotional campaign that is tied to the upcoming release of The Twilight Saga: Eclipse which has its world premiere on June 30.

 

In the novels, the hero Edward Cullen drives a Volvo S60R - the previous S60 model. However, when the time came to make the films, Volvo was no longer producing the S60R so a Volvo C30 was used in the first film and a Volvo XC60 in the next two.

 

Volvo Car's appearance in the first film in the franchise, Twilight, led to increased sales of the Volvo C30 at several Volvo dealers, particularly in the US market. After the release of The Twilight Saga: New Moon, dealers reported increased interest in the Volvo XC60 and noted that customers came to showrooms to photograph their children in the "Twilight car". Volvo is being increasingly perceived by youngsters as "cool", and moms of teenagers are showing increasing interest, thanks to the enthusiasm of their kids.

 

"Above all, of course, we are really pleased that the image of the Volvo brand has changed among many of the young people who in a few years' time will be our potential customers. They perceive the brand as attractive and one that stands out from the crowd," says Oliver Engling.

About the TWILIGHT SAGA film series

The TWILIGHT film series stars Kristen Stewart and Robert Pattinson and tells the story of 17-year-old Bella Swan who moves to the small town of Forks, Washington to live with her father, and becomes drawn to Edward Cullen, a pale, mysterious classmate who seems determined to push her away. But neither can deny the attraction that pulls them together...even when Edward confides that he and his family are vampires. The action-packed, modern day vampire love story TWILIGHT, the first film in the series, was released in theatres on November 21, 2008 to a blockbuster reception. The second instalment of the film franchise, THE TWILIGHT SAGA: NEW MOON was released 20 November, 2009. The franchise has grossed over $1.1 billion in worldwide box office ticket sales to date.
